Hi, and welcome to on-call for Spokewise, our bike-share rebalancing tool. Most pages come from the van-routing optimizer timing out during morning peak; it's safe to retry once before escalating. Please read the dock-capacity caveats carefully before touching configs. The full runbook and escalation ladder are documented here.

wiki page, tahaf-tajog: https://jira.ordindyn.corp/pipeline

Handover: Exportron retry queue

Hi Mira — handing over the failed-export retries. Exports that hit a timeout land in the retry queue and get three attempts with backoff; after that they're parked and need a manual requeue from the admin panel. Watch for customers reporting duplicates — that usually means a double requeue. The current retry settings are as follows.

settings of bajog-fawig:
oliael:
  log_level: warn
  metrics_host: metrics.oliael.zemvarsys.internal
  pin: 0267
  pool_size: 32

## Data Stores — Password Reset Revamp

The revamped reset flow for Quillgate stores one-time tokens in the `reset_tokens` table with a 15-minute TTL, hashed at rest. Legacy tokens are invalidated during cutover by the Larkspur migration job. Release verification requires confirming token expiry behaviour against staging; connect using the string that follows.

replica DSN, kajep-yahag: mssql://praok_svc:iF@db-8d68.plorvaio.local:5432/eliion